Librocubicularist, word art by Amy Crook

Librocubicularist: one who reads in bed,
5″x7″ pen & ink and Copic marker on paper

I had a lot of choices for who to draw here, but in the end Hermione seemed like the perfect embodiment of this hard-to-pronounce* word.

Besides, it gave me a chance to draw an unflattering cat selfie of Crookshanks, which is a joy not to be underestimated.

Selcouth, word art & Star Wars fan art by Amy Crook

Selcouth: unfamiliar, unusual; strange, marvelous, wonderful,
7″x5″ pen & ink on paper – $70

This was the word art for May the Fourth, aka Star Wars day! Selcouth seemed to perfectly fit the fantastical world that was at once strange, marvelous, and wonderful, and of course BB-8 wanted to guest star as the perfect avatar of all of the above.
